January National Alcohol Days
1st - Bloody Mary Day
New Year's Day might leave you feeling worse for wear due to the aftermath of the New Year's Eve night before. How about treating your hangover with 'hair of the dog', and enjoying a bloody mary on its national alcohol day? A savoury and spicy delight that will lift your spirits after a hectic night prior.
11th - National Hot Toddy Day
If you haven’t heard of Hot Toddy, then you are missing out. A warming, cosy drink made using your choice of rum brandy or whisky, served with honey, lemon, water and a cinnamon stick for the pièce de résistance. A great drink to commemorate the colder months and keep you feeling nice and toasty.
25th - Irish Coffee Day
Are you thinking of having your usual black coffee on January 25th? Think again. Irish Coffee Day is the best day of the year to add an extra kick to your morning brew.
